Chairperson Child Protection & Welfare Bureau (CPWB) Sarah Ahmad conducted a visit to the Child Protection Institute in Gujranwala to assess the quality of care, education, and other services being provided to abandoned children.
During her visit, she distributed Eid gifts to the children and engaged them in games to lift their spirits.
Moreover, Sarah Ahmad presided over a meeting with the institute's staff to evaluate their performance and provide guidance for improving the care of the children and facilities. She directed the district officer to collaborate with the Technical Education & Vocational Training Authority (TEVTA) to provide technical and vocational education to the children, thereby enabling them to secure livelihoods in the practical world.
